Structure the code to respect MVC design pattern.
[Persons_Comparator.git] / src / PersonView.java
1 import javax.swing.*;
2
3 public class PersonView extends JPanel {
4 private FirstnameView firstnameView;
5 private OriginView originView;
6 private SizeView sizeView;
7 private WeightView weightView;
8 private EyeView eyeView;
9
10 public FirstnameView getFirstnameView() {
11 return firstnameView;
12 }
13
14 public void setFirstnameView(FirstnameView firstnameView) {
15 this.firstnameView = firstnameView;
16 }
17
18 public OriginView getOriginView() {
19 return originView;
20 }
21
22 public void setOriginView(OriginView originView) {
23 this.originView = originView;
24 }
25
26 public SizeView getSizeView() {
27 return sizeView;
28 }
29
30 public void setSizeView(SizeView sizeView) {
31 this.sizeView = sizeView;
32 }
33
34 public WeightView getWeightView() {
35 return weightView;
36 }
37
38 public void setWeightView(EyeView eyeView) {
39 this.eyeView = eyeView;
40 }
41
42 public void setEyeView(EyeView eyeView) {
43 this.eyeView = eyeView;
44 }
45
46 public EyeView getEyeView() {
47 return eyeView;
48 }
49 }